One of the best reasons to build a custom home (other than superior craftsmanship) is to have it reflect your personal design choices. All those dreams you've imagined over the years will come to fruition in your new home.  |
Arched entry door and facade
|
The owners of our featured home did just that. From the arched entry door, to the beautiful individual Master Bath vanities faced in tile to the faux beams mounted in the recessed ceiling of the Great Room, the look of this home is definitely theirs alone. The Master Bath (photo top) also features a white washed armoire for storage, tile back splashes with wall mounted faucets and glass vessel bowls that add a modern touch to the overall European feel .  |

Even the guest bath receives a touch of whimsy with the "antique" pedestal sink that has burnished bronze faucets and a delightful iron sculpted base. The stained glass oval not only adds privacy for the front facing window, but allows beautiful light to bathe the space in soft colors.
The individuality of this home is enhanced by the addition of warm colors, interesting textures and a definite flair for color that reflect the owners personality!
